Core Viewpoint - The Ministry of Transport reported that the overall economic operation of the transportation sector in 2025 is stable and progressing steadily [1] Group 1: Transportation Production - Transportation production continues to grow, with operating freight volume, port cargo throughput, and inter-regional passenger flow all showing year-on-year increases [4] - The operating freight volume for 2025 is projected to reach 58.7 billion tons, a year-on-year increase of 3.2%. By mode, freight volumes for rail, road, waterway, and civil aviation are expected to grow by 2%, 3.4%, 3.2%, and 13.3% respectively [4] - The express delivery business volume is expected to reach 199 billion pieces, reflecting a year-on-year growth of 13.7% [4] Group 2: Port Cargo Throughput - Port cargo throughput is expected to reach 18.34 billion tons in 2025, with a year-on-year growth of 4.2%. Domestic and foreign trade throughput is projected to grow by 4% and 4.7% respectively [5] - Container throughput is anticipated to reach 35 million TEUs, a year-on-year increase of 6.8%, with domestic and foreign trade container throughput growing by 2.4% and 9.8% respectively [5] Group 3: Inter-Regional Passenger Flow - Inter-regional passenger flow is projected to reach 66.86 billion person-times in 2025, with a year-on-year increase of 3.5%. By mode, passenger volumes for rail and civil aviation are expected to grow by 6.7% and 5.5% respectively, while road passenger flow is projected to increase by 3.3% [5] Group 4: Transportation Fixed Asset Investment - Transportation fixed asset investment is expected to exceed 3.6 trillion yuan in 2025. By mode, railway investment is projected at 901.5 billion yuan, while road and waterway investments are expected to exceed 2.6 trillion yuan, and civil aviation investment is projected at 120 billion yuan [5]
